First of all: This ingredient will come last, but we’re going to get it ready first. Throw some semi-sweet chocolate (either squares or chocolate chips) into a glass bowl and set it over a saucepan of simmering water. Stir it around until it’s all melted and smooth, then set it aside so it cools down a little bit.

Throw four tablespoons of butter into a saucepan…

And melt it over medium-low heat.

Throw in a bag of large marshmallows…

And (you can’t see this, but that’s where faith comes in) a good dash of salt. These treats do not lack in the sweet department, and the salt helps balance that a bit.

Stir around the marshmallows…

Until they’re totally melted…

And perfectly smooth.

Grab a big ol’ spoonful of Nutella…

And plop it on in there.

Then decide that wasn’t enough Nutella and add some more.

Stir around the marshmallow/Nutella mixture until it’s all combined…

And at the very end, throw in a little more butter just to finish it off and also to be naughty.

Throw a bunch of Rice Krispies into a large bowl and pour in the Nutella/marshmallow mixture while folding with a big spatula. This is always a sticky, gooey mess, and the more gradually you can add in the sticky mixture, the better.

When it’s almost totally mixed together, throw in some mini-marshmallows…

And keep mixing until it’s all combined. You might need to get in there with your (very clean, sprayed with cooking spray) hands if the spatula isn’t doing the works.

Then press the mixture into a 9 x 13-inch pan that’s been generously, liberally, abundantly sprayed with cooking spray.
